Solution - AMI megaraid driver doesn't work with Linux 2.4.x kernels
Hei The Ami megatrends driver (at least for 471, 475, and 493) does not work with 2.4.x kernels. The solution we got from Ami is to update the firmware of these cards to version FW G158. This update will fix all the problems with ami raid-devices in 2.4.x kernel without changing the driver. We don't know when AMI will release a fixed firmware (hope soon) but we got it by e-mail. If there is anybody with the same problem I can sent the firmware-update by mail.
